單片機(jī)編程符號(hào)定義表
- 文件介紹:
- 該文件為 txt 格式,下載需要 0 積分
- 單片機(jī)編程符號(hào)定義表
符號(hào)定義表
符號(hào) 含義
Rn R0~R7寄存器n=0~7
Direct 直接地址,內(nèi)部數(shù)據(jù)區(qū)的地址RAM(00H~7FH)
SFR(80H~FFH) B,ACC,PSW,IP,P3,IE,P2,SCON,P1,TCON,P0
@Ri 間接地址Ri=R0或R1 8051/31RAM地址(00H~7FH) 8052/32RAM地址(00H~FFH)
#data 8位常數(shù)
#data16 16位常數(shù)
Addr16 16位的目標(biāo)地址
Addr11 11位的目標(biāo)地址
Rel 相關(guān)地址
bit 內(nèi)部數(shù)據(jù)RAM(20H~2FH),特殊功能寄存器的直接地址的位
指令介紹
指令 字節(jié) 周期 動(dòng)作說明
一、算數(shù)運(yùn)算指令
1.ADD A,Rn 1 1 將累加器與寄存器的內(nèi)容相加,結(jié)果存回累加器
2.ADD A,direct 2 1 將累加器與直接地址的內(nèi)容相加,結(jié)果存回累加器
3.ADD A,@Ri 1 1 將累加器與間接地址的內(nèi)容相加,結(jié)果存回累加器
4.ADD A,#data 2 1 將累加器與常數(shù)相加,結(jié)果存回累加器
5.ADDC A,Rn 1 1 將累加器與寄存器的內(nèi)容及進(jìn)位C相加,結(jié)果存回累加器
6.ADDC A,direct 2 1 將累加器與直接地址的內(nèi)容及進(jìn)位C相加,結(jié)果存回累加器
7.ADDC A,@Ri 1 1 將累加器與間接地址的內(nèi)容及進(jìn)位C相加,結(jié)果存回累加器
8.ADDC A,#data 2 1 將累加器與常數(shù)及進(jìn)位C相加,結(jié)果存回累加器
9.SUBB A,Rn 1 1 將累加器的值減去寄存器的值減借位C,結(jié)果存回累加器
10.SUBB A,direct 2 1 將累加器的值減直接地址的值減借位C,結(jié)果存回累加器
11.SUBB A,@Ri 1 1 將累加器的值減間接地址的值減借位C,結(jié)果存回累加器
12.SUBB A,#data 2 1 將累加器的值減常數(shù)值減借位C,結(jié)果存回累加器
...